Serene Custard & Golf, a Family Owned Business for Over 60 years!

Originally built in 1959 and owned by the Gorgo family and named for the family’s matriarch Serene, the roadside custard stand has been a Vineland landmark ever since. It is one of the longest-operating businesses in the Vineland area.

Since its opening in 1959, there have only been four owners of the establishment: the Gorgos, the Littmans, and the Rones, who sold the business in early 2022 to Robert Scarpa and Katie Chillari, who immediately began to renovate the building to what it is today.

In 1996, an 18-hole miniature golf course was added. It is one of the few miniature golf courses in South Jersey that is not located on a boardwalk. It is regarded as one of the most challenging courses in the tri-state area. The course — which includes a walk-thru cave, waterfall, three ponds, and over 500 plants — underwent an upgrade in the Spring of 2022.
